The Beauty of Black Gold: A Versatile Addition to your Jewelry Collection

The black gold look is a popular trend for those who are looking for a distinctive and edgy style. Black gold jewelry has an edgy, dark, or blackened appearance typically achieved through an amalgamation of alloys with a surface treatment. It is a unique and distinct blend of metals that gives a dark, metallic finish that gives it an interesting and sophisticated appearance.

Black gold jewelry is typically made by adding a black rhodium coating to traditional gold, giving it its distinctive color. One of the biggest advantages of black gold jewelry is its long-lasting nature. The black rhodium coating is very resistant to wear and tear, which makes it a great choice for wear and tear. Black gold jewelry is also a unique and stylish alternative to silver and gold jewelry.

Composition

Black gold is not a naturally occurring metal, however, it is produced by mixing it with other alloys or metals. The most popular method is the addition of alloys like rhodium, cobalt, or ruthenium to in order to give it a black appearance.

Surface Treatment

Gold jewelry with black color can be treated with treatment techniques that improve its dark color and endurance. These treatments include plating, oxidation, or any other coating process that is specialized.

Durability

The wear and tear of jewelry made of black gold depends on the alloys used and the treatment methods used. It is generally recommended to handle gold jewelry in black cautiously to avoid damaging or scratching the surface.

Maintenance

Black gold jewelry requires special attention to keep its beauty. Avoid exposure to extreme chemicals, abrasive materials or extreme heat. Cleansing with mild soapy water and a soft, clean cloth will get rid of dirt and oils. Avoid using abrasive cleaners or brushes.

Hypoallergenic Considerations

If you are allergic or have sensitive skin, it’s important to determine the exact composition of the black gold jewelry you are considering. Some alloys or surface treatments might contain components that can trigger skin irritation It is therefore important to choose jewelry that is hypoallergenic or suitable for your skin type.

Style and versatility

Black gold jewelry has a contemporary aesthetic. Black gold jewelry can be combined with diamonds and other gemstones to create an eye-catching contrast or paired to create a more minimalist style. It is a very popular option for wedding rings, engagement ring bands, earrings, necklaces, and bracelets.

Availability

Black gold jewelry is available from numerous different jewelry makers and retailers. However, due to the specialized methods involved in its production black gold jewelry can be less plentiful and more expensive than traditional gold jewelry.
